Transaction 41e6c5cfccf9153e77242110cfadab92af9fc29b161efdef31ef65d79f782988
1 Input
1 Output
-
41e6c5cfccf9153e77242110cfadab92af9fc29b161efdef31ef65d79f782988:0
- value
- 150800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 944a3746dcd537c69763902df5435b871c0bba9c OP_EQUAL
- address
- 3FD6qYi91Uk85tkt6AH3wT94yyyJUtc8D6